If you are contemplating it and feeling gun shy, I would suggest a short retreat as your first trip. Short retreats are great because they give you a taste of what it’s like to travel solo without the big commitment. They’re liberating — a real confidence-builder.

Thinking of solo travel for the first time?

Before I embarked on my own for long trips, I took weekenders to different locations to see what it was like. One example: I live in Toronto, so I Googled “retreat in Ontario” and found Thirteen Moons This is a fantastic vegetarian retreat for women located near Peterborough Ontario. When I arrived, I was warmly welcomed by Louise the owner and her lovely dog Red-Dog.

Louise is a fantastic cook, the grounds were beautiful and it was a tranquil experience. It definitely made me feel prepared for other solo travel experiences that I have since accomplished.
